R&R Rebuttal (io-rebuttal)

An IO R&R is a strong signal — first-round accepts are rare at the field's leading IR journal. The editors return anonymous expert reviews with a decision letter and adjudicate, so the response must move every reviewer toward yes on the IR theory and design while keeping the editor confident the revision is convergent — and keep the package verifiable for the post-conditional-acceptance check.

When to trigger

  • An R&R decision arrived and you are planning the revision + response memo
  • Reviewers disagree (e.g., a rationalist and a constructivist referee pull in opposite directions)
  • A reviewer requests analyses or model changes that would alter the paper's claims
  • Writing the cover note to the editor summarizing the revision

Strategy

  1. Read the editor's letter as the rubric. The editor signals which points are decisive — solve those first; the editor adjudicates disagreements among referees.
  2. One point-by-point response, every comment addressed. Quote each comment, then respond. Never skip one — silence reads as non-compliance.
  3. Concede or rebut explicitly, with evidence. For each: did what was asked (say where, with the new text/table number), or push back respectfully with a reason (IR theory, level of analysis, identification, or evidence). A well-argued disagreement beats a hollow capitulation that weakens the theory.
  4. Reconcile paradigm-driven conflicts openly. When a rationalist referee and a constructivist referee want opposite things, say so, choose a principled path consistent with your IR argument, and explain the tradeoff to the editor. Don't silently satisfy one and ignore the other.
  5. Protect the contribution. Add robustness, scope conditions, and clarifications; resist changes that dilute the generalizable IR claim that earned the R&R. Defend the international-level mechanism rather than over-claiming.
  6. Keep anonymity intact in the revised manuscript (still double-blind; third-person self-citation), and keep results and formal proofs re-runnable so IO staff verification after conditional acceptance stays fast (see io-transparency-and-data-policy).

Response-memo format

For each reviewer comment:

> [Quoted reviewer comment]

Response: [What we did / why we respectfully disagree, in IR terms].
Change: [Section/page/table-figure number where the revision appears].

Open with a short summary of the main changes to the editor; group by reviewer; end each entry with the location of the change so the editor can verify quickly.

Referee-objection playbook (the recurring IO pushbacks and their fixes)

Most IO R&R comments fall into a few families, each with a concede-or-rebut posture that protects the generalizable IR claim.

Referee objection Default posture The move
"Selection into treaty membership" concede, defend design add a ratification-timing/instrument or selection model; report what changes
"Mechanism institution→outcome unspecified" concede state the cross-border mechanism and add its observable implication as a test
Rationalist vs. constructivist referees clash adjudicate openly pick the path consistent with your theory; explain the tradeoff to the editor

Worked rebuttal vignette (illustrative)

Reviewer 2 (rationalist) calls the treaty-compliance result "just selection." Reviewer 1 (constructivist) wants more on norm internalization. The editor flags selection as decisive. The response (a) answers the editor's decisive point first — a ratification-timing design plus sensitivity analysis shows the effect attenuates by about a third but stays positive (illustrative), in a new SI table; (b) reconciles the paradigm conflict openly — R1's norm channel enters as a scope-conditioning mechanism, not a rival, consistent with the commitment theory; (c) ends each entry with the section/table location. The revised analysis stays scripted so IO's post-acceptance re-run still passes.

Anti-patterns

  • Ignoring or merging away a comment without a visible response
  • Capitulating to a request that breaks the IR argument or the level of analysis just to please a referee
  • Defensive or dismissive tone toward expert referees
  • "We thank the reviewer" with no actual change or argued reason
  • Adding analyses that quietly contradict the original claim without acknowledging it
  • Letting the revised manuscript or new exhibits/proofs drift out of sync with the package IO will verify
  • Satisfying one paradigm's referee by silently abandoning the rival's concern the editor also weighs
